The Nutribullet PowerCore XL Blender stands out for its spacious capacity, allowing ingredients to blend smoothly without overcrowding. Its user-friendly features make it quick and easy to prepare a variety of foods and drinks, earning a place as a helpful kitchen companion.

  • Large capacity accommodates family-sized smoothies and meals
  • Simple controls with just a few preset options
  • Performant with various foods but struggles with ice

What happened

The Nutribullet PowerCore XL Blender was tested extensively for smoothie blends, pancake batters, milkshakes, and slushies, revealing its strengths in handling larger quantities of food thanks to its extra spacious container. The design allows ingredients to blend more thoroughly without crowding, vastly improving texture and consistency.

Users found it easy to assemble and operate immediately with minimal learning curve, featuring two preset functions plus variable speed settings. Though the blender worked well overall, it showed some limitations such as less effective ice crushing compared to competitors and minor inconveniences in food removal and pouring.

Why it feels good

Having a blender with ample room can be a game-changer in preparing meals or drinks for families or meal preps. The extra capacity of the PowerCore XL means no more splitting recipes into batches, saving time and effort in the kitchen. It also ensures smoother blends with less gritty textures, especially noticeable in items like steel-cut oats batters.

The straightforward design makes it less intimidating than highly complex blenders crowded with buttons and options. Few presets and a simple speed dial mean anyone can get started quickly, making it a great choice for those wanting better blending performance without fuss.
